Technically, no, the combat doesn't include a rest. You can "do stuff" like explore, search, or fight, for 5 turns, and then must rest for one, or get tired. The extra time that puffs the fight up to 10 minutes is kind of an abstraction that includes stuff like binding wounds and searching bodies, and generally getting yourselves back into order. Looking back at the history of it, turns used to be less strictly time-bound, I think, and the idea is that the combat would get you closer to needing a rest, rather than "really" taking 10 minutes on a real clock. There's definitely some time distortion going on when you think of it that way, though.

Here, we're sort of at the point where you can go one more turn's worth of activity, then you should take a rest. I'd count contemplation (the original goal in coming over to this room) as being "restful" if you wanted to do that, whether here or somewhere else.
